The door in the face is a common persuasion technique studied in social psychology and can be described as an attempt to convince someone to comply by asking for an exaggerated or large request that the persuaded person will most likely reject, followed by then soliciting a more reasonable request that the persuaded subject will most likely agree on, influenced by their feelings of guilt.

When a crowd of people clap or cheer, it is difficult to tell just how loud each individual is applauding or cheering. If people tend to clap louder when they are alone than when they are in a crowd, they are probably engaging in __________.
When people tend to clap louder when they are alone than when they are in a crowd, they are probably engaging in social loafing.
Explanation:
Social loafing is the general tendency of an individual to put in more effort while working independently rather than when being in a crowd or group.
An individual’s clap will not be heard or noticed in a group clap or cheer.
When everyone in a group works together at the same time, it is difficult to assess an individual’s effort. This is because the entire effort is being pooled within the group itself so as to reach the common goal of everyone and there is no individual goal.
This leads to a lot of issues in the workplace quite often. The person becomes a sort of a bystander and will not be ready to take up responsibilities.
Social loafing can be corrected by arranging smaller groups and by engaging an individual’s responsibilities and activities.

What should be changed to make the following sentence true? ""The stress model suggests that people with a predisposition for a disorder are more likely to develop the disorder when faced with stress.""
The sentence should use the term 'diathesis-stress model' to accurately illustrate that both genetic predisposition and environmental stress contribute to the development of a disorder when an individual is faced with stress.
Explanation:The statement should be changed to reference the diathesis-stress model instead of the "stress model." The corrected sentence will read: "The diathesis-stress model suggests that people with a predisposition for a disorder are more likely to develop the disorder when faced with stress." The diathesis-stress model posits that a combination of genetic predisposition and environmental stress can result in the manifestation of psychological disorders.
According to the diathesis-stress model, individuals have certain vulnerabilities or predispositions (diatheses) for developing a disorder that may be activated under the right conditions of environmental or psychological stress. Not all individuals with a predisposition will develop a disorder; it is the interaction between the diathesis and stress that increases the risk.
Therefore, the appropriate change to the sentence to reflect the correct terminology and concept would be to include "diathesis-" in front of "stress model." This acknowledges that a predisposition for a disorder interacting with stress may trigger the development of that disorder.

The emotional center of the brain that is activated when a person with an addiction sees a person, place, or thing that reminds him of their addiction (e.g., needle, slot machine, white powder) is called the:
Answer:
The correct answer is: the amygdala
Explanation:
Addictive behaviors and withdrawal effects are strongly related to emotional symptoms. Addiction occurs primarily in the brain, where various regions are involved. The brain region most commonly associated to addiction behaviors and patterns is the amygdala, which affects both memory and emotions.
The formation of memories in the brain is accompanied by association with feelings. When a person develops an addiction, the memory of incurring in the addiction triggers a pleasant emotional state, which leads to the repetition of the behavior and ultimately to the formation of habits.
